Baton Rouge African-American History Museum Moving to New Location

Out with the old, in with the new! The Baton Rouge African-American History Museum was founded in 2001 and curated for 18 years by the late Sadie Roberts-Joseph. It is notably Baton Rouge’s only museum dedicated to African and African American history. This month, the museum is renovating and moving to 805 St. Louis Street. The move is in part funded by a benefit concert, aptly named “Legacies to Afrofutures” that was held last month and cohosted by The Walls Project. Once reopened, the museum will have plenty of room to showcase its important collection of artifacts. braamuseum.org
